On the surface of earth acceleration due to gravity is g and gravitational potential is V match the following:

Table - 1 Table -2
(A) At height h = R value of g (P) decrease by a factor (1/4)
(B) At depth h = (R/2) (Q) decrease by a factor (1/2)
(C) At height h = R value of v (R) increase by a factor (11 / 8)
(D) At depth h = (R/2) value of v (S) increase by a factor 2
(T) None

On the earth surface acceleration = g & potential is V

(A) g' = [g / {1 + (h/R)}2] --------- acceleration at height h.

at h = R

g' = [g / {1 + (R/R)}2] = (g/4)

i.e. decrease by factor (1/4)

(B) at depth d, g' = g[1 – (d/R)]

here   d = (R/2)

   g' = g[1 – {(R/2) × (1/R)}] = (g/2)

i.e.   decreases by factor (1/2)

(C) gravitational potential ∝ distance       i.e.      V ∝ (R + h)

  at height h = R, V becomes twice of original value.

(D) None option.
